[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]Tenant selection is critical. Read up on horror stories by landlords. The reality is that a tenant can stop paying rent, trash the house, and force you to go through a months-long eviction process just to remove them. You can’t afford to make a bad decision. Do extensive background investigation on tenants and if you have a bad feeling about someone, trust your gut. Never give a reason for rejecting someone. Try to find tenants via word of mouth or other non-public means. For instance, every university has visiting professors each year. If you have a contact at one, tell them you’re renting a house and see if they can find someone in need.[/quote] These people are known as professional tenants by experienced property managers. They figure out how to game the system. Even if the LL wins, you end up with months of lost income and property damage if you are tricked by one of these fools.[/quote]
